Transaction 320bfdd90a693006bb76475ab7093cc1a08e796ed7d8959c98a670370c661013
1 Input
1 Output
-
320bfdd90a693006bb76475ab7093cc1a08e796ed7d8959c98a670370c661013: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3324e65d7b081f052009370a477da8679a8b90ae OP_EQUAL
- address
- 9w6hL29VZR8fZaLiCqGdVYeFgbkyTPQSm4